The Meaning of Geretti: Exploring the Origins of a Surname

When it comes to surnames, the name Geretti holds a special significance. Derived from various types of hypocoristic forms, including dialectal ones, Geretti is believed to have its roots in names such as the medieval Germanic Fillinger or Rodegerius, among others.

The Origins of Geretti

The surname Gerini has a lineage in Trieste, one between Savona and Imperia, another between La Spezia and Massa, one in the Florentine area, one in the Ancona area, and one in the Roman area. Gerino, almost unique, appears to originate from Imperia.

On the other hand, Geretti is typically Friulian from Udine, while Geretto is more common in Venice. Gerin, on the other hand, is typical of the areas of Gorizia and Trieste, with a presence also in the Udine region.
